Nearly 65 Children Sickened by Fruit Pouches Tainted With Lead: FDA

Published on December 8, 2023

More than 60 toddlers across the nation have reported lead toxicity linked to apple puree pouches that were recently recalled due to dangerous lead contamination, according to the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A). The agency said in a statement that it had received 64 reports of adverse events potentially linked to the recalled products as of Dec. 5, up from 57 cases reported last week. To date, the reports span 27 states and involve children under the age of 6, the FDA announced in its latest update on the investigation. As of Dec. 5, cases have been reported in Alabama, Arkansas, California, Connecticut, Florida, Georgia, Iowa, Illinois, Kentucky, Louisiana, Massachusetts, Maryland, Michigan, Missouri, North Carolina, Nebraska, New Hampshire, New Mexico, New York, Ohio, Pennsylvania, South Carolina, Tennessee, Texas, Virginia, Washington, and Wisconsin....
